NOGALES, Ariz. - Two men have been arrested after federal agents pulled over a semi-truck northeast of Nogales and discovered more than a ton of marijuana inside.

The truck was stopped about 10 p.m. Thursday on Old Tucson Highway and a U.S. Border Patrol canine detected the presence of marijuana. Agents say a subsequent search of the vehicle led to the recovery of 100 bundles of marijuana weighing more than 2,400 pounds. The seized marijuana has an estimated street value of nearly $2 million.

Authorities say the driver of the semi-truck was 46-year-old Martin Ignacio Contreras-Angulo, who was arrested along with 19-year-old passenger Vicente Aron Ochoa-Tapia. Both men have been charged with possession of marijuana with intent to distribute.

Contreras-Angulo is from Mexico and Ochoa-Tapia is a U.S. citizen, but their hometowns were not immediately available Friday.
